German Chancellor Merkel had a meeting with Foreign Minister Wang Yi, who attended the Munich Security Conference. She wrote: "An equal and solid partnership is essential. In this process, we will safeguard our own interests and values and stand on our own strength with confidence. Thank you, Wang Yi, for the exchange."

Comment: Merkel's remarks set a new tone of pragmatism and firmness for Sino-German relations: acknowledging the necessity of equal cooperation, maintaining the practical interests of Sino-German trade and industrial chains, while clearly placing its own interests, values, and independent strength first. In short, in the future, Sino-German relations will only discuss matters that can be cooperated, avoid difficult-to-compromise differences, maintain distance politically, and maintain necessary economic ties, neither deliberately intensifying nor actively breaking up, entering a pragmatic but distant normal state.
